SNDR(4)								       SNDR(4)

NAME
       sndr - SNDR parameter values

SYNOPSIS
       /etc/default/sndr

DESCRIPTION
       The  sndr  file resides in /etc/default and provides startup parameters
       for the sndrd(1M) and sndrsyncd(1M) daemons.

       The sndr file format is ASCII and comment lines begin with  the	cross‐
       hatch  (#)   character.	Parameters consist of a keyword followed by an
       equal (=) sign followed by the parameter value of the form:

	 keyword=value

       The following parameters are currently supported in the sndr file:

       SNDR_THREADS=num

	   Sets the maximum number of connections allowed to the  server  over
	   connection-oriented	transports.  By default, the number of connec‐
	   tions is 16.

       SNDR_LISTEN_BACKLOG=num

	   Sets connection queue length for the RDC TCP over a connection-ori‐
	   ented transport. The default value is 10 entries.

       SNDR_TRANSPORT=string

	   Sets	 the  transport	 used  for  the	 RDC  connection.  If  IPv6 is
	   installed, the default value is "/dev/tcp" or "/dev/tcp6."
